In 1860, Lincoln K Britton entered the world in Hilliard, Franklin, Ohio, USA, born to Samuel Taylor Britton And Maria Hyde Lattimer. Lincoln K Britton married Lydia D Dyer, and had children including Florence Viola Britton. Lincoln K Britton passed away in 1938 in Hilliard, Franklin County, Ohio, United States of America.
